P
Начало Новости Поздравления Рецепты
Menu
×

API-шлюзы для сетевой безопасности: ключевые аспекты и лучшие практики

Сегодня в эпоху цифровой трансформации и повсеместного использования облачных технологий, безопасность сети и инфраструктуры становится как никогда важной. Одним из основных элементов обеспечения этой безопасности являются API-шлюзы. Они служат надежной защитой и централизованной точкой управления для множества приложений, обеспечивая безопасность передачи данных и интеграцию между различными системами. В этой статье мы подробно рассмотрим, что такое API-шлюзы для сетевой безопасности, их ключевые функции и лучшие практики для их внедрения.

Что такое API-шлюз?

API-шлюз — это программное обеспечение, которое выступает в роли входной точки для API-запросов, поступающих от внешних клиентов к серверной системе. Основная задача API-шлюза заключается в оптимизации и управлении потоками данных между различными компонентами системы. Он выполняет функции маршрутизации, преобразования протоколов и регулирования доступа. Эта промежуточная точка позволяет администрировать степень доступности и защищённости приложений, сохранять их целостность и поддерживать высокую доступность.

Функции API-шлюза

  1. Маршрутизация запросов: API-шлюзы анализируют входящие запросы и направляет их к соответствующим микросервисам системы.
  2. Аутентификация и авторизация: API-шлюзы обеспечивают проверку подлинности пользователя и предоставляют доступ к ресурсам только при наличии необходимых прав.
  3. Регистрация и аналitika: они собирают и анализируют метрики использования API для дальнейшего улучшения функционала и безопасности.
  4. Обмотка и управление трафиком: контроль за количеством запросов помогает избежать перегрузок.
  5. Фильтрация и отказоустойчивость: предоставляют возможности ограничения доступа к данным при потенциальных угрозах.

Почему API-шлюзы критически важны для сетевой безопасности?

Сетевая безопасность — важнейший аспект для любой современной организации, особенно если речь идет о продуктивных облачных развертываниях. API-шлюзы играют ключевую роль в защите данных благодаря следующим возможностям:

  • Централизованное управление: API-шлюзы позволяют централизованно управлять входами и выходами данных, минимизируя уязвимости.
  • Защита от DDoS-атак: они могут обнаруживать и блокировать потенциальные атаки, предотвращая выход из строя серверов.
  • Шифрование данных: обеспечивают передачу данных по безопасным протоколам, защищая их от перехвата.
  • Соответствие нормативным требованиям: помогают организациям соответствовать стандартам безопасности, таким как GDPR и PCI DSS.
  • Масштабируемость: с их помощью приложения могут без проблем масштабироваться с минимальными рисками для безопасности.

Лучшие практики для внедрения API-шлюзов

Чтобы максимально эффективно использовать API-шлюзы, рекомендуется придерживаться ряда лучших практик:

  1. Регулярное обновление и патчи: поддерживайте программное обеспечение API-шлюза в актуальном состоянии, чтобы закрывать уязвимости.
  2. Минимизация доступа: настройте доступ к точкам API по принципу минимальных привилегий.
  3. Активное логи и мониторинг: внедряйте системы отслеживания и логирования для быстрого обнаружения потенциальных угроз.
  4. Использование шифрования: применяйте стандарты шифрования как для защиты данных в транзите, так и для хранимых данных.
  5. Учтите отказоустойчивость: настройте автоматические переключения на резервные узлы в случае сбоев.

API-шлюзы для сетевой безопасности — это важный инструмент для организаций, стремящихся защитить свои цифровые активы и обеспечить надежное обслуживание для своих клиентов. Следуя лучшим практикам и оставаясь в курсе технологических инноваций, компании могут создать надежный и безопасный ИТ-ландшафт.


Вам может быть интересно прочитать эти статьи:

Мониторинг мобильных приложений: Дашборды для контроля и аналитики

Эффективность и Преимущества Бессерверных Архитектур в IT

Облачные системы управления тестированием CloudOps: обзор и лучшие практики

Управление микросервисами для планирования ресурсов

Эффективное Развертывание API: Лучшие Практики и Советы

Уязвимости сканеров DevOps: Практики безопаности и лучшие подходы

Инструменты для миграции в облако: ключевые аспекты и лучшие практики

Мониторинг Безопасности Событий с Kanban: Лучшие Практики и Методы

Безопасность рабочих процессов: как обеспечить надежную защиту

Архитектуры на основе серверлесс в iOS: новые горизонты разработки

Платформы для реагирования на IT-инциденты: Определение, преимущества и лучшие практики

Гейты API Kanban: Эффективная интеграция и управление

Управление тестированием систем ИТ-безопасности

Виртуализация инструментов для сетевой безопасности: ключевые аспекты и лучшие практики

Тестирование платформ виртуализации: Лучшие решения и практики

Инструменты распределения ресурсов в Agile: Обзор и рекомендации

Стратегии автоматизации: Советы и лучшие практики

Настройка VPN на Linux: Подробное Руководство

API-шлюзы в контексте ITIL: Основы и практики

Организация управления мобильными устройствами с помощью Scrum: как внедрить и оптимизировать процесс

Системы Предотвращения Потери Данных в Linux: Обзор и Лучшие Практики

Управление Патчами в IT-Системах Безопасности: Важность и Лучшая Практика

Серверлесс архитектуры на Linux: Обзор и Лучшая Практика

Эффективное управление патчами для обеспечения IT-безопасности

Уязвимости Windows: выявление и исправление с помощью сканеров